### Step 4: Enable the CSV Import Wizard

The Pellbright import wizard ships disabled by default in staging. Flip `IMPORT_WIZARD_ENABLED=true` in the deploy config, then confirm the column-mapping presets load from the Quarrow cache. Row validation runs synchronously, so batches over 50k rows should be chunked. The wizard also needs its upload token, so append this line to the environment file:

sealed setting: ARCHIVE_KEY3=8d0

Ticket: DEDUP-412 — Connection failures during customer record dedup

The Larkspur dedup job started failing overnight with pool exhaustion errors. It merges duplicate customer records in batches of 500, but the batch worker isn't releasing connections after a merge conflict, so the pool drains within twenty minutes. Proposed fix: wrap merges in a try/finally release and cap retries at three. For the sync, reproduce against staging using the connection string below.

primary connection of bagep-kaweg = clickhouse://rusdor_svc:3TXlgH7O8DuUYI@db-ae3f.zarqelgrid.internal:5432/zordor

# Basement Archive Room — Night Access

The archive room under Pellworth House holds old contracts and the tape backups. Night shift: take stairwell C, not the lift (it's switched off after midnight). Lights are on a timer by the door — slap the button as you go in. Sign the logbook, even at 3am, yes really. The keypad by the door takes the code below.

staff pass of fahap-tajeg = bdg-FT-6

**TKT-4471: Garage feed vault locked out**

Hey folks — the Lottkey vault holding creds for the Stackton parking-garage occupancy feed locked itself after too many bad attempts (thanks, stale bookmark). Feed's been stale since this morning. New team members: don't retry logins, you'll extend the lockout. Just reset the vault with the recovery passphrase below.

recovery phrase for kadup-yahap: oliix-eliir

## Further reading

If you're touching the retention sweeper, skim this section first. The sweeper walks the Hollowpine archive tables nightly, deleting rows past their retention class — and yes, deletes are permanent, there's no undo bucket. Most contractor mistakes come from misreading the retention class mappings, so please don't guess. The mappings, sweep schedule, and dry-run instructions are all kept on the internal page below:

operations page: https://confluence.qorvellabs.internal/pages/projects/projects/projects